1Select the correct past tense verb form to complete the sentence describing a completed past action: 'Ontem, o aluno ________ a redação para o professor.'
A.entregou
B.entregava
C.entregar
D.entregaria
Explanation: The Pretérito Perfeito do Indicativo ('entregou') is used for actions completed at a specific point in the past ('ontem').
2Which verb form correctly completes the sentence expressing doubt: 'Duvido que eles ________ a tempo para a conferência.'?
A.chegam
B.cheguem
C.chegaram
D.chegarão
Explanation: Verbs of doubt such as 'duvidar que' trigger the Presente do Subjuntivo ('cheguem').
3Complete the sentence with the appropriate verb form: 'É necessário que você ________ todos os documentos até sexta-feira.'
A.envia
B.enviou
C.envie
D.enviará
Explanation: Impersonal expressions of necessity followed by 'que' ('É necessário que...') require the Presente do Subjuntivo ('envie').
4Choose the correct future tense form for the sentence: 'Amanhã nós ________ o novo projeto cultural.'
A.apresentávamos
B.apresentássemos
C.apresentemos
D.apresentaremos
Explanation: The Futuro do Presente do Indicativo ('apresentaremos') expresses an action scheduled to take place in the future ('amanhã').
5Which form of the verb 'ir' correctly completes this conditional statement: 'Eu ________ ao concerto se tivesse comprado o bilhete.'?
A.iria
B.vão
C.fui

6Select the correct form of 'ter' for the hypothetical clause: 'Se eu ________ mais tempo livre, aprenderia a tocar guitarra portuguesa.'
A.tenho
B.tivesse
C.tiver
D.terei
Explanation: Hypothetical 'se' clauses paired with a conditional main clause ('aprenderia') require the Pretérito Imperfeito do Subjuntivo ('tivesse').
7Complete the sentence with the correct verb form: 'Quando você ________ a Lisboa, não se esqueça de visitar Belém.'
A.chega
B.chegasse
C.chegar
D.chegou
Explanation: Temporal clauses introduced by 'quando' referring to a future event require the Futuro do Subjuntivo ('chegar').
8Identify the correct Personal Infinitive (Infinitivo Pessoal) form: 'É fundamental os estudantes ________ o vocabulário em contexto.'
A.praticar
B.praticavam
C.pratiquem
D.praticarem
Explanation: When an infinitive has an explicit subject ('os estudantes') distinct from the main clause, the Personal Infinitive form with third-person plural suffix '-em' ('praticarem') is required.
9Which option correctly uses the Pretérito Mais-que-perfeito to show an action prior to another past action?
A.Quando o comboio chegou, a Maria já tinha saído da estação.
B.Quando o comboio chega, a Maria já saiu da estação.
C.Quando o comboio chegar, a Maria já vai sair da estação.
D.Quando o comboio chegasse, a Maria já saía da estação.
Explanation: The compound Pretérito Mais-que-perfeito ('tinha saído') expresses a past action that occurred before another past action ('quando o comboio chegou').
10Complete the sentence with the appropriate verb form: 'Oxalá nós ________ um dia de sol para o passeio de barco.'
A.temos
B.tenhamos
C.tínhamos
D.teremos
Explanation: The word 'Oxalá' (hopefully / would that) expresses a wish and always triggers the Presente do Subjuntivo ('tenhamos').
